Bug Description
When I choose network install in the alternative downloads section on the ubuntu home page, I get forwarded to
http://
Note that this is a http link, so the download is untrusted at this point.
I can't find trustworthy checksums which available via https on a page from ubuntu.

Please always make at least sha2 and sha256 checksums available for all media downloads.
The checksums must be provided via https on a domain ending with ubuntu.com. Everything else may NOT be considered trustworthy by users.
